P. 1
Computer Software Tests Term S

Computer Software Tests Term S

Views: 0|Likes:
Published by ebooker97
and style stage , html coding stage , assessment stage , shipping and delivery along with servicing
and style stage , html coding stage , assessment stage , shipping and delivery along with servicing

More info:

Published by: ebooker97 on Nov 18, 2012
Copyright:Attribution Non-commercial


Read on Scribd mobile: iPhone, iPad and Android.
download as PDF, TXT or read online from Scribd
See more
See less





Computer Software Tests Term

Find under the particular meaning/definition of conditions commonly used in computer software assessment. These kind of meanings get in an exceedingly simple and effortlessly simple to comprehend vocabulary. Software growth living period (SDLC) SDLC consists of distinct levels for instance Initial/Planning stage , need evaluation stage , design and style stage , html coding stage , assessment stage , shipping and delivery along with servicing stage. All these kind of levels could be implemented individually linearly because Waterfall product or perhaps they can be implemented because V-model that wants performing assessment pursuits in parallel together with growth pursuits. Initial stage consists of collecting requirements through reaching the consumer. nOrmally enterprise analyzer can do this kind of all of which will prepare a need document. Here consumer will be the internal marketing team in case of product development. In any other case consumer will be the individual who can be spending money on performing the particular project. Requirement evaluation stage consists of performing detailed examine with the consumer requirements along with judging choices along with range with the requirements. And yes it consists of tentative arranging along with technology & source selection.

SRS (technique need specs ) will probably be created within this stage. Design stage consists of splitting up the full project straight into quests along with sub-modules through performing advanced designing (they would.l.deb ) along with low level designing (l.l.deb ). Coding stage consists of generating source rule or perhaps program through the computer programmers through mentioning the style document. Html coding requirements together with suitable remarks needs to be implemented. Testing stage consists of getting clarification to the unclear requirements and then creating check cases through assessment team based on the requirements. Along with , the particular assessment team may perform the test cases once the construct can be unveiled and they'll survey the particular insects identified during the check case delivery. Delivery & servicing stage consists of installing the application inside consumer place along with

supplying the facts for instance release notes to the consumer. Maintenance or perhaps support team will help the shoppers if they deal with just about any problem while using the program. Software assessment it's the process of verifying no matter whether the software application or even a computer software merchandise satisfies the company along with techie requirements. I-e verifying whether the designed software application performs not surprisingly. It will probably be made by comparing your result against the predicted result. Functional & Non-functional Testing Functional assessment primarily is targeted on verifying whether the features asked for inside need document are working appropriately. Non-functional assessment can be examining the particular overall performance , stability , scalability, user friendliness , internationalization along with safety with the software application. Testing methods Whitebox, blackbox along with Greybox are generally three assessment procedures. White field assessment will probably be made by heading thro the particular html coding by knowing the criteria utilized in the particular html coding. It includes API assessment along with rule protection. Black field assessment will probably be accomplished without knowing internal structure or perhaps html coding with the program. It can help to locate far more insects properly. Though the ethusist may spend more time through creating a lot of check cases to evaluate a thing that could have been examined effortlessly through creating one check case. Grey field assessment consists of having knowledge of internal information buildings along with sets of rules with regard to creating the test cases , but assessment on the user , or perhaps black-box level Testing levels Unit assessment or perhaps element assessment will probably be made by the particular developers to ensure that the little little bit of the particular rule performs appropriately. Each every product with the program will probably be examined so as to affirm whether the circumstances , functions along with rings are working great or otherwise not. Integration assessment will reveal problems inside connects along with discussion in between a number of quests with the program. System assessment will probably be made by the particular assessment team to ensure that this system or perhaps program satisfies the requirements. It involves GUI computer software assessment , user friendliness assessment , overall performance assessment , anxiety assessment , safety assessment , Scalability assessment , peace of mind assessment , smoke cigarettes assessment , random assessment , etc..

Regression assessment may completed to make certain that the application or perhaps program is not afflicted with just about any rule change completed to the application. I-e previously doing work functions in other quests with the program must always function after changing the module. We need to check every a part of program even if the particular rule change is conducted in any distinct element or perhaps module with the program. Automatic resources will probably be useful for performing regression assessment. Alpha assessment has to be a part of user endorsement assessment. It'll be carried out the particular developers assumption , and you will be made by the shoppers or perhaps through unbiased check team. Beta assessment employs leader assessment. Try out versions with the computer software will probably be unveiled to your small group of people outside the programming team. Actual release will probably be accomplished in case there are no major issues seen in try out assessment. eBook with regard to learning computer software assessment along with QTP automatic. Testing Artifacts Test plan's the document that describes the particular objectives , range , tactic , while keeping focused of an computer software assessment work. It'll be presented with regard to team of developers along with business owners also in order to recognize the particular assessment pursuits made by assessment team. It covers the characteristics being examined along with features 't be examined. Testing atmosphere facts , risks , tasks , assessment routine , check deliverables along with source portion facts will probably be contained in the check prepare. So, it'll be useful to possess overall watch with the assessment pursuits being carried out distinct release of the software application. Traceability matrix is simply a mapping relating to the requirements along with the check cases. It'll be prepared in the tabular variety. I-e in shine spread published. Once column can have their email list with the need IDs and the next column that have check case IDs that check in which need. It will make certain that check cases are generally composed sufficiently to cover all of the requirements. Similarly we are able to possess opposite Traceability matrix also. I-e mapping in between check cases along with the requirements. It will make certain that we aren't having just about any check cases to the requirements which are not necessarily questioned through the consumer. Test selection will be the variety of the test cases. Mainly most appropriate check cases will probably be grouped as you check case document. For instance , the test cases that can check the particular logon module will probably be stored in a specific spread published document known as because login_testcases.xls. It may include info for instance identify with the module , explanation , final amount of check cases along with specifics of guide document (i-e need document , make use of

case ,etc ). Test case can have under issues. Test case identity with regard to distinctly determining the test case. For instance , check case identity could be TC001,TC002,. Test case explanation can have issue that we will check. e.gary to ensure user views what it's all about invalid logon details if they get into appropriate login name along with invalid password Test methods will offer facts or perhaps methods necessary for executing this kind of check case e.gary a single. Go to the logon page 2. Get into appropriate login name. 3. Get into invalid security password. 4. Click login option. Expected result will offer information regarding the habits or perhaps result we ought to notice once after executing the test methods. e.gary user must notice invalid logon details information in beautiful red colors with the surface of the web site. Author which creates this kind of check case. Automatable- to be able to tag no matter whether this kind of check case could be programmed using automatic resources for instance QTP. Apart previously mentioned issues we are able to increase pass/fail along with remarks although executing the test cases. Test case could be authored by mentioning make use of case document along with need document. Organic beef need to relate the application with regard to creating check cases. We may use several methods for instance Equivalence partitioning along with border value evaluation with regard to creating check cases. According to be able to Equivalence partitioning , creating one check case for every partition with the input data is sufficient. For illustration , if a security password discipline allows minimum 4 people along with greatest 10 people , after that you will have three dividers. Initial one is a legitimate partition 4 to be able to 10. Second can be invalid partition of ideals under 4. 3 rd one is another invalid partition of ideals over 10. We are able to get one value through every partition to perform the particular assessment. In this kind of illustration the particular border ideals determined by border value evaluation are generally 3 ,4 ,your five , nine ,10 and11. Software check living period. Test arranging range with the assessment will probably be defined in line with the budget assigned to the assessment. Along with , check prepare document will probably be made by the test boss.

Test development- check cases will probably be authored by the particular assessment team (QA team ) during this stage. Check documents also will always be created. Test execution- test candidates may perform the test cases all of which will survey the difficulties to the team of developers with regard to fixing these people. Performance check needs to be accomplished just following well-designed along with regression assessment got completed. Bug tracking will be the technique employed to follow up the particular bugs/defects/issue identified during check delivery. There are many totally free resources (elizabeth.gary Bugzilla.) designed for performing bug tracking properly. Normally the particular bug will probably be monitored because standard bug living period. It can have under says. New: each time a ethusist locates the bug very first time the state will probably be NEW. Consequently the particular bug is not yet authorized. Open: after a ethusist provides put up the bug , the lead with the assessment team may verify whether the reported bug is honest along with the he will customize the state because OPEN. Assign: the particular developerment team steer may assign the particular bug to be able to distinct developer with regard to fixing that. nOw the state will probably be transformed to be able to ASSIGN. Ready-to-Test: once the developer corrects the particular bug , he will assign the particular bug to the assessment team with regard to next circular of assessment using the position READY-TO-TEST. Deferred: the particular position will probably be transformed to be able to DEFERRED when the team determines to fix that in next release or even the goal is extremely reduced. Rejected: when the developer determines that the bug is not authentic , he can reject the particular bug. Then this state with the bug is changed to be able to REJECTED. Duplicate: when the bug can be repeated two times or even the actual leads to for just two insects are generally very same , then one bug position will probably be transformed to be able to DUPLICATE. Verified: once the bug can be set along with the position is changed to be able to Ready-to-test, the particular ethusist exams the particular bug once more. When the bug is not present in the software , he grants that the bug can be set along with adjustments the particular position to be able to VERIFIED. Reopened: when the bug nevertheless is out there even after the particular bug can be set through the developer , the particular ethusist will change the particular position to be able to REOPENED.

The particular bug go thro living period once again. Closed: once the bug can be set , it'll be examined through the ethusist once more. When the ethusist confirms that the bug no longer is out there inside computer software , he adjustments the particular position with the bug to be able to CLOSED. This kind of state signifies that the particular bug can be set along with examined once more. Reporting- check synopsis survey needs to be devised for describing the particular methods used with regard to supplying high quality merchandise. This kind of synopsis survey must show how many check cases accomplished , the number of approved and the way a lot of hit a brick wall , check protection , deficiency thickness as well as other check measurements. Along with , it should show overall performance check result also. hoc wordpress

You're Reading a Free Preview

/*********** DO NOT ALTER ANYTHING BELOW THIS LINE ! ************/ var s_code=s.t();if(s_code)document.write(s_code)//-->